The term travel insurance is often heard when you book a flight ticket. Not many people are aware that Indian Railways too offers travel insurance at less than 50 paise per passenger. However, only Indian citizens are eligible to apply for insurance cover through IRCTC website or mobile app. 

If you are booking a train ticket via IRCTC website or mobile app and wish to buy the insurance cover, you need to select the ‘Travel Insurance’ option while booking the ticket. The premium will be automatically added to the ticket cost. You will receive policy information through a SMS and on the registered email IDs directly from the insurance companies and also a link will be provided to fill in the nomination details. The policy is available for all passengers traveling by train, including AC and non-AC classes.

IRCTC offers a travel insurance policy for passengers at a nominal premium of  Rs 0.35 (35 paise). Passengers who buy the insurance get compensated for any loss of valuables and luggage during their train journey. Not only that, the insurance policy provides a cover of up to Rs 10 lakh in case of death, permanent disability, or hospitalisation due to an accident during the journey.

The passengers can claim insurance within four months of being in a train accident. They can file a claim for insurance by visiting the office of the insurance company.
